Release Notes

yarnpkg/yarn (yarn)

v1.22.22

Compare Source

  • Fixes a punycode warning.

  • Fixes a hoisting issue when transitive dependencies themselves listed aliases as dependencies.

v1.22.21

Compare Source

[!WARNING]
This release is missing a couple of artifacts (the .msi/.rpm/.deb/.asc files); we're working on fixing this.

  • Fixes an issue in the v1.22.20 when calling Yarn from a project subfolder, outside of a Corepack context.

  • Added a SKIP_YARN_COREPACK_CHECK environment variable to skip the Corepack check.

v1.22.20

Compare Source

[!WARNING]
This release is missing a couple of artifacts (the .msi/.rpm/.deb/.asc files); we're working on fixing this.

  • Important: Punycode is now embed within the bundle, as it has been deprecated by Node.js and will be removed in a future version.

  • A message will be displayed when Yarn 1.22 notices that the local project has a package.json file referencing a non-1.x Yarn release via the packageManager field. The message will explain that the project is intended to be used with Corepack.

  • The yarn-error.log files won't be generated anymore, as we don't process non-critical 1.x bug reports (we however process all bugs reported on https://github.com/yarnpkg/berry; we just released the 4.0.2 release there).

  • The yarn set version x.y.z command will now install the exact x.y.z version (prior to this change it used to first install the latest version, and only in a second step would it downgrade to x.y.z; this was causing issues when we bump the minimal Node.js version we support, as running yarn set version 3.6.4 wouldn't work on Node 16).

  • Prevents crashes when reading from an empty .yarnrc.yml file.
